EDITORS COMMENTS
This print showcases a remarkable artifact from ancient Egypt, known as the Dagger of the New Kingdom. Created during the Egyptian 20th Dynasty, specifically between 1156 and 51 BC, this exquisite piece is crafted from wood and bronze. Measuring an impressive length of 32.4 cm, it currently resides in a private collection. The dagger's handle is adorned with intricate carvings depicting the head of Hathor, an important goddess in Egyptian mythology associated with love, beauty, and motherhood. This depiction adds a touch of divine elegance to an already stunning weapon. What makes this dagger even more fascinating are the inscriptions found on its blade. These hieroglyphic writings provide valuable insights into the time period it was created in and potentially reveal details about its purpose or significance within ancient Egyptian society.
